Tumor Size and Location: The Foundation of Surveillance

The physical characteristics of your acoustic neuroma are primary drivers of how frequently you’ll be monitored.

Small and Asymptomatic Tumors: A Watchful Waiting Approach

If your acoustic neuroma is detected incidentally, meaning it was found during imaging for another reason, and it’s small (typically less than 1-2 cm) and not causing any noticeable symptoms, your monitoring schedule might be more spaced out.

Initial Observation Periods: Establishing a Baseline

In many cases of small, asymptomatic tumors, the initial period of observation is crucial. This allows your medical team to establish a baseline of your tumor’s growth rate. You might undergo an MRI scan roughly six months to a year after your diagnosis.

Long-Term Surveillance: Gradual Lengthening of Intervals

If the initial scans show no significant growth, the intervals between MRIs will likely be extended. You might transition to annual scans for a few years, and then, if stability continues, the frequency might be reduced to every 18 months or even two years. The key here is to catch any subtle growth early without subjecting you to unnecessary scans and associated costs.

Larger or Symptomatic Tumors: More Frequent Scrutiny

Conversely, if your acoustic neuroma is larger or is already presenting with symptoms such as hearing loss, tinnitus, dizziness, or facial numbness, a more frequent monitoring schedule is usually recommended.

Closer Follow-up Post-Diagnosis: Rapid Assessment of Progression

For larger or symptomatic tumors, your initial follow-up might be as frequent as every three to six months. This allows your medical team to closely monitor any progression and to intervene with treatment if necessary.

Adjusting Based on Symptom Changes: A Dynamic Approach

The presence and severity of your symptoms play a significant role. If you experience any new or worsening symptoms, it’s imperative to report them to your doctor immediately, as this may necessitate an earlier MRI scan even if you’re on a longer monitoring schedule.

Growth Rate: The Pace of Change Matters

The observed growth rate of your acoustic neuroma is a critical determinant of your monitoring frequency. Acoustic neuromas are known for their slow growth, but there can be variations.

Slow or Stable Growth: Extended Monitoring Intervals

If your MRIs consistently show little to no growth over several years, your monitoring intervals will likely become longer. This indicates a stable tumor, and the risk of rapid progression or significant symptom development is lower.

Rapid Growth: Increased Urgency and Treatment Considerations

In rare instances, an acoustic neuroma might exhibit a faster growth rate. If your scans reveal significant growth over a relatively short period, your medical team will likely recommend more frequent monitoring (e.g., every six months initially) and will discuss treatment options with you. Rapid growth increases the risk of pressure on surrounding brain structures and exacerbation of symptoms.

The Tools of Surveillance: How Acoustic Neuroma is Checked

The primary method for monitoring acoustic neuroma is through imaging technology. Understanding these tools will help demystify the process.

Magnetic Resonance Imaging (MRI): The Gold Standard

MRI is the cornerstone of acoustic neuroma surveillance. It provides highly detailed images of the brain and its structures, allowing for precise measurement of the tumor and detection of any changes.

Importance of Contrast Agents: Enhancing Visibility

Often, your MRI scans will involve the administration of a contrast agent (usually gadolinium) intravenously. This dye highlights the tumor tissue, making it appear brighter on the scan and allowing for more accurate assessment of its size, shape, and any changes compared to previous scans.

Detecting Subtle Changes: The Contrast Advantage

Contrast agents are particularly useful for detecting small tumors or subtle increases in tumor size that might not be visible on non-contrast scans. They also help differentiate the tumor from surrounding brain tissue.

Potential Side Effects of Contrast: What to Expect

While generally safe, contrast agents can have side effects in rare cases, such as allergic reactions or kidney issues in individuals with pre-existing kidney disease. Your doctor will discuss these risks with you before administering contrast.

MRI Sequencing: Tailoring the Scan

Your doctor might specify certain MRI sequences to be performed. These are different ways of acquiring images that can provide varying types of information. For example, specific sequences are optimized to visualize the internal auditory canal, where acoustic neuromas originate.

Focusing on the Vestibular Nerve: Specialized Sequences

Specialized MRI sequences might be used to specifically focus on the vestibular nerve and the internal auditory canal, ensuring that any changes in this area are precisely captured.

Comparing Scans Over Time: The Crucial Comparison

The real value of an MRI in acoustic neuroma surveillance lies in comparing your current scan with previous ones. Experienced radiologists and neuro-oncologists meticulously analyze these images to identify any growth or changes in the tumor’s characteristics.

Audiometry: Assessing Hearing Function

While MRI visualizes the tumor, audiology tests assess the impact of the tumor on your hearing. Since acoustic neuromas are on the auditory nerve, hearing changes are a common symptom and can also be an early indicator of tumor growth.

Baseline Hearing Tests: Establishing Your Starting Point

Before your monitoring schedule is finalized, you will likely undergo a comprehensive audiology evaluation to establish your baseline hearing. This includes pure-tone audiometry to determine your hearing thresholds across different frequencies and speech discrimination tests to assess your ability to understand spoken words.

Tracking Hearing Deterioration: An Early Warning System

Regular audiometry tests allow your medical team to track any gradual decline in your hearing, which could be an early sign of tumor growth putting pressure on the auditory nerve.

Differentiating Tumor Effects from Other Causes: A Nuanced Approach

It’s important to note that hearing loss can have many causes. Audiometry helps differentiate hearing loss related to the acoustic neuroma from other age-related changes or other ear conditions, providing a more complete picture of your condition.

The MRI Appointment: Preparation and Procedure

Your MRI appointments are a routine part of your acoustic neuroma management.

Pre-Appointment Instructions: What to Do Beforehand

You’ll likely receive instructions regarding any necessary dietary restrictions (especially if you’re having contrast), informing the technician of any metal implants or devices you have (as MRI uses magnets), and wearing comfortable clothing without metal components.

Informing About Medical Devices: Safety First

It is crucial to inform the MRI staff about any pacemakers, cochlear implants, aneurysm clips, or other metal prosthetics you may have, as these can interfere with the MRI or pose a safety risk.

Pregnancy and MRI: Important Considerations

If you are pregnant or suspect you might be, you must inform the radiology department before your scan, as MRI is generally considered safe in pregnancy, but precautions are taken.

During the MRI Scan: What Happens in the Machine

The MRI machine is a large, tube-like device. You will lie on a movable table that slides into the scanner. The technician will communicate with you through an intercom system. The scanner produces loud knocking and buzzing noises, which are normal. You may be given earplugs or headphones for comfort. You will be asked to remain as still as possible during the scan to ensure image clarity.

Staying Still: The Key to Clear Images

Movement can blur the images, making them difficult to interpret. Following the technician’s instructions to remain still is paramount for accurate results.

The Importance of Open Communication: Your Comfort and Safety

If you experience claustrophobia or discomfort during the scan, communicating this to the technician is important. There are often open MRI machines available for those with severe claustrophobia, though image quality can sometimes be slightly different.

The Audiology Appointment: Assessing Your Hearing

These appointments focus on evaluating your auditory and sometimes vestibular function.

Hearing Tests by an Audiologist: The Detailed Evaluation

An audiologist will conduct a series of tests, including pure-tone audiometry, speech audiometry, and tympanometry. These tests assess your ability to hear different frequencies and volumes, understand speech, and evaluate the function of your middle ear.

Tumor Growth Thresholds: Defining Significant Change

Medical professionals typically have established thresholds for what constitutes “significant” tumor growth that warrants further discussion and potential treatment.

Small Increments of Growth: Usually Managed Conservatively

An acoustic neuroma growing by just a millimeter or two over several years is often considered stable and might not necessitate immediate intervention, especially if it’s not causing symptoms.

Larger or Accelerated Growth: Prompting Treatment Discussions

However, if the tumor shows a more substantial increase in size over a shorter period, or if its growth is causing or likely to cause significant symptoms, treatment options will be actively discussed.

Symptom Development and Severity: The Patient Experience

The emergence or worsening of symptoms is a major driver for considering treatment.

New or Worsening Hearing Loss: A Common Concern

If you experience a significant and rapid deterioration in your hearing, or if your tinnitus becomes unbearable, these symptoms often prompt a re-evaluation of your management plan.

Impact on Daily Functioning: Quality of Life Considerations

The impact of your symptoms on your daily functioning, your work, and your overall quality of life will be a significant factor in treatment decisions.

Balance Issues and Facial Nerve Involvement: Urgent Concerns

Dizziness, vertigo, and any signs of facial nerve weakness (such as facial numbness or paralysis) are often treated more urgently due to their potential to significantly impact quality of life and, in rare cases, indicate more aggressive growth.

FAQs

1. What is acoustic neuroma?

Acoustic neuroma is a non-cancerous tumor that develops on the main nerve leading from the inner ear to the brain.

2. How often should acoustic neuroma be checked?

The frequency of check-ups for acoustic neuroma depends on the size and growth rate of the tumor, as well as the individual’s symptoms and overall health. Generally, regular monitoring through MRI scans is recommended.

3. What are the symptoms of acoustic neuroma?

Symptoms of acoustic neuroma may include hearing loss, ringing in the ear, dizziness, and balance problems. In some cases, the tumor may grow large enough to press against the brain, causing more severe symptoms.

4. What are the treatment options for acoustic neuroma?

Treatment options for acoustic neuroma include observation, radiation therapy, and surgical removal of the tumor. The choice of treatment depends on the size and growth rate of the tumor, as well as the individual’s overall health and preferences.

5. What are the potential complications of acoustic neuroma?

Potential complications of acoustic neuroma include hearing loss, facial weakness or numbness, balance problems, and in rare cases, pressure on the brain leading to more severe neurological symptoms. Regular monitoring and appropriate treatment can help manage these complications.
